       | hrunt wrote:
       | Ha! That wizard brings back memories.
       | 
       | I remember in the late 90s Microsoft introducing text-to-speech
       | recognition through those characters. I hooked that wizard up to
       | the output from my IRC client. Anytime a message would come to
       | the channel with my name, the wizard would speak the message. Of
       | course, within a few minutes, the entire channel was flooded with
       | people calling me dirty names. Good times.
